Second-order optical nonlinearity in thermally poled multilayer germanosilicate thin films
-
Altmetric Citations
Description
The Maker fringe method and second-harmonic light microscopy were applied to investigate the second-order optical nonlinearity induced in thermally poled silica thin films. It was found that the nonlinearity in Ge-doped film was more than three times that in pure silica film.
